Great Lakes Women's Shelter Fundraiser
Friday 25 July 2025 | Tuncurry Beach Bowling Club

Join us for an inspiring afternoon in support of a truly vital cause. The Great Lakes Women’s Shelter Fundraiser Luncheon returns to Tuncurry Beach Bowling Club on Friday 25 July 2025, and promises to be an unforgettable event filled with purpose, passion, and a few good laughs! Proudly supported by Zoom Energy.

Hosted by Renee Gartner

A familiar face on Australian television and a passionate advocate for women’s issues, Renee Gartner brings energy, insight and warmth to every event she hosts. With a background in sports media and charity work, Renee is the perfect host for this powerful day of community connection and giving.

Special Guest Speakers

Paul Sironen – A legend of rugby league, Paul is a former NSW State of Origin and Australian international forward. Known for his toughness on the field and generosity off it, Paul brings stories of resilience, leadership and mateship that will captivate any audience.

Kurt Gidley – Former captain of the Newcastle Knights, NSW Blues and Australian representative, Kurt’s career has been marked by determination, humility and heart. He’ll share stories from his career and how sport shaped his views on community and wellbeing.

Michelle Lee – Australia’s first woman to row solo across the Atlantic Ocean. Michelle is an adventurer, motivational speaker and embodiment of fearless determination. Her story of rowing 5,000km alone through wild seas is as inspiring as it is empowering.

Entertainment by Darren Carr

One of Australia’s most awarded ventriloquists and comedians, Darren Carr delivers comedy with a twist. His razor-sharp wit and clever characters have earned him multiple Mo and ACE Awards – and he’ll have you laughing out loud.

Tickets & Booking

🎟 Tables of 10 – $1,300
🎟 Individual Tickets – $150 each
Includes a delicious 2-course meal, plus beer, wine and soft drinks throughout the event.

Enjoy raffles, auction items, and lucky door prizes, all while supporting an incredible cause. Every dollar raised will go directly to Great Lakes Women’s Shelter, helping women and children in crisis in our local community.
